Carnegie Mellon University
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Carnegie Mellon University.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Engineering Schools in Pennsylvania For Those Making $0-$30k. Carnegie Mellon is a private not-for-profit institution located in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. The school has a fairly large population, and it awarded 35 ’s degrees in 2020-2021.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at Carnegie Mellon, the school also landed the #1 spot in our “Best General Engineering Schools in Pennsylvania”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Carnegie Mellon is $16,456 for Pennsylvania Engineering students whose families make $0-$30k.

With a freshman retention rate of 96%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students. The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 0.7%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. Since the school has a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 5 to 1, those pursuing a degree will have more opportunities to interact with their professors.

Swarthmore College
Swarthmore, Pennsylvania

Out of the 8 schools in the Best Value Engineering Schools in Pennsylvania For Those Making $0-$30k that were part of this year’s ranking, Swarthmore College landed the #2 spot on the list. This small school is located in Swarthmore, Pennsylvania, and it awarded 23 ’s engineering degrees in 2020-2021.

Swarthmore also made our “Best General Engineering Schools in Pennsylvania” list, coming in at #3. The estimated yearly cost for Swarthmore College is $4,594 for pennsylvania engineering students whose families make $0-$30k.

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 86%. The und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 7 to 1 is a sign that students will have more opportunities to engage with their professors one-on-one.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 0.7%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.

Lafayette College
Easton, Pennsylvania

Out of the 8 schools in the Best Value Engineering Schools in Pennsylvania For Those Making $0-$30k that were part of this year’s ranking, Lafayette College landed the #3 spot on the list. Lafayette College is a small school located in Easton, Pennsylvania that handed out 19 ’s engineering degrees in 2020-2021.

Lafayette also took the #4 spot in our “Best General Engineering Schools in Pennsylvania” ranking. It costs about $11,728 for pennsylvania engineering students whose families make $0-$30k per year to attend Lafayette.

The low undergrad student loan default rate of 0.3%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. With a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 9 to 1, it’s easy to see that the school is committed to helping their undergraduates succeed.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 87%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.
